Riders
in conjunction with and backed by
The Harley-Davidson Motor Company, are proud to offer
you the opportunity of hiring a Harley-Davidson.
All
rentals are late-model Harley-Davidson motorcycles that
have been serviced and maintained according to Harley-Davidson
Motor Company standards. There are 4 models displayed
above available for rental (subject to availability).

| BENEFITS |
- European
HOG 24 hour emergency roadside assistance for
breakdown.
- Fully
comprehensive, third party, fire & theft
insurance cover, and accidental damage cover
(UK only) included in hire cost. European mainland
cover will cost only an additional £40 per week.
- 250
Miles a day are included in your hire. (Excess
daily mileage is charged at 15p per mile.)
- Motorcycle
clothing is available but we recommend you supply
your own.
- The
use of a Harley-Davidson DOT approved helmet
and rainsuit is available.
- Secure
and ample luggage storage is available on site.

REQUIREMENTS
|
- Hirers
must be aged 25 to 69 and hold a full motorcycle
licence.
- A
number of ID's will be needed before hire may
commence, e.g. passport, driving licence, credit
card etc. Non-UK resident hirers will be required
to sign a jurisdiction waiver.
- A
£1000 deposit is required at the time of collection
(usually an unprocessed amount on a credit card).
- Daily
rate bikes must be returned no later than 24
hours after collection
- On
return the bike you have a full fuel tank.
- Hire
payment will be required before the commencement
of the hire period.
- Reservation
deposit required.
- Renters
must possess the skills, knowledge and ability
to operate a heavyweight motorcycle.
